Saint-André-Les-Vergers, a region in the Aube department of north-central France, offers a landscape characterized by local green spaces and proximity to the extensive natural areas of the Aube, including the Forêt d'Orient Regional Nature Park. The area's name, "les Vergers" (the orchards), reflects its historical connection to agriculture and its enduring rural charm. This setting provides varied terrain suitable for several sports like road cycling, touring cycling, mountain biking, hiking, and more.

The broader Aube department features dedicated greenways, such as the Greenway of the Great Lakes Seine and Aube, which connects to the Forêt d'Orient Regional Nature Park. Touring cyclists can explore routes like the Greenway of the Great Lakes Seine and Aube, which extends approximately 26 miles (42 km) and connects to the Forêt d'Orient Regional Nature Park. Another option is the greenway along the Haute-Seine canal, offering about 28 miles (45 km) of shaded cycling. Find more options in the Cycling around Saint-André-Les-Vergers guide.
While Saint-André-Les-Vergers has local green spaces, the wider Aube department offers more challenging mountain biking terrain. Routes such as the JBS Triptych Off-road bike circuit and the Montaigu bike circuit incorporate forests, fields, and wooded hills. Hikers can enjoy local green areas like Ile Germaine, Bert Cotins, and Fontaine Saint-Martin. The nearby Forêt d'Orient Regional Nature Park is a primary attraction, featuring numerous trails around its three large artificial lakes. These trails offer diverse ecosystems and opportunities for birdwatching. Refer to the Hiking around Saint-André-Les-Vergers guide for more information.
Yes, the greenways in the Aube department, such as the Greenway of the Great Lakes Seine and Aube, are generally flat and accessible, making them suitable for families. Within Saint-André-Les-Vergers, a 5.9-mile (9.5 km) green trail crosses wooded areas like Ile Germaine, suitable for gentle rides. These routes provide safe and scenic options for all ages.
The region is close to the Forêt d'Orient Regional Nature Park, which features three large artificial lakes: Lac d'Orient, Lac du Temple, and Lac Amance. These areas are known for their rich biodiversity and serve as habitats for thousands of migratory birds. The greenways also offer scenic views of plains, forests, and lake shores.
